WALL STREET JOURNAL: "Campaign That Never Rests" - 7/5/2013
EXCERPT - Mr. Liu is the most stridently anti-Mayor Michael Bloomberg candidate in the Democratic field. He wants to abolish the police practice of stop and frisk, not change it like his opponents.

THE NATION: "The Powerful Lesson of New York's Police Oversight Law" - 7/3/2013
EXCERPT - It is well established that Democratic candidate John Liu is his party’s most outspoken critic of stop-and-frisk and the surveillance of Muslim communities.

WNET CHANNEL 13: "MetroFocus Full Episode: NYC Mayoral Candidate John Liu" - 6/26/2013
EXCERPT - On stop and frisk: "It’s creating a huge amount of distrust and a separation between the community and the police. When that happens its more difficult for the police to do their job and everybody is less safe."

NEW YORK TIMES: "Public Safety and the Mayor’s Race" - 4/25/2013
EXCERPT - John Liu, the current comptroller, yelled, "Stop and frisk in New York City is the biggest form of systemic racial profiling we have anywhere in the United States of America, and it has to be ended."

WNYC: "Mayoral Candidates Talk Public Safety Post-Bloomberg" - 3/20/2013
EXCERPT - City Comptroller John Liu is the only mayoral candidate calling for an end to stop-and-frisk.
